CT Imaging Specialist
2 weeks ago
The CT Imaging Specialist will exemplify professionalism and service excellence while executing the following responsibilities:
- Preparation and Supplies: Acquire necessary medical, surgical, and radiological supplies for specific procedures in accordance with established protocols.
- Field Sterility: Ensure the sterility of the field and instruments throughout the procedure.
- Patient Communication: Effectively communicate with patients and their families before, during, and after procedures to alleviate anxiety while upholding the patient's privacy and dignity.
- Compliance: Adhere to all HIPAA regulations, ensuring the confidentiality of patient information.
- Patient Verification: Confirm patient identification in line with established policies.
- Monitoring: Observe the patient's condition before and after contrast injections, reporting any sudden changes to nursing staff and radiologists.
- Record Management: Ensure availability of medical records, previous reports, lab results, and patient history.
- Emergency Preparedness: Be ready to initiate emergency response in case of complications.
- Supply Management: Maintain adequate linen, contrast media, and biopsy/drainage supplies in each scanning room.
- Inventory Participation: Engage in daily inventory checks and restocking of supplies, notifying the Lead of any expired or soon-to-expire equipment or medications.
- Equipment Maintenance: Participate in the routine cleaning of the CT gantry, table, and peripheral equipment after each use.
- Workflow Coordination: When assigned as Point, triage procedures according to the daily schedule, ensuring timely coordination of all emergency and unscheduled procedure requests.
- Interdepartmental Communication: Maintain communication with all departments regarding patient status and ensure immediate transport post-procedure.
- Routine Procedures: Assist in performing routine procedures and assess patient tolerance for contrast, screening for allergies and medication incompatibilities.
- Quality Assurance: Maintain QA/QC requirements for daily, monthly, and ACR specifications, recognizing unusual conditions in equipment operation and alerting appropriate personnel of malfunctions.
- Protocol Adherence: Follow venipuncture and power injector protocols, ensuring timely processing of images for urgent cases.
- Collaboration: Notify the radiologist of any unusual findings to provide optimal patient care.
